12,858. Elliott, C. B. June 8. Balls for golf &c. are made of strips of stockinette or other elastic fabric impregnated with soft indiarubber or balata. This material is stretched to the limit of the fabric, and wound to the proper size, either by itself or upon a core 3, and is covered with a shell 4 of gutta-percha or hard india-rubber. String or yarn may be used instead of a strip of fabric.
